no one will be interested in changing applications if the new application
doesnt do something new or better. very few users will switch from an
application which is a little hard to use but does everything they want,
to something which is easier to use but is lacking in an often used or
requested functionality.

users are drawn by features.  they stick around if they have a good
experience (re: good usability, good UI design, good feature set, good
interaction, good chance that it will continue to be improved over time,
etc.).
